A consequence of this mechanism is the initiation of caspase-three dependent apoptosis of human DCs by LF . The StxB subunit is a symmetric homopentameric ring composed of 5 equivalent B subunits. However, regardless of its symmetric construction, StxB associates with StxA asymmetrically by having solely three of its B subunits interacting with the C-terminus of the A2 fragment, thus making StxA bend to the side opposite from the three B subunits . This conformation is seen within the B subunits of different AB toxins, which bind to particular receptors with specific glycolipids or glycoproteins. StxB preferentially binds to globotrioylceramide and facilitates the internalization of StxA into the target cell . However, it has been discovered recently that StxB, which was believed to be the non-poisonous subunit of Stx, actually has significant toxic exercise within the goal cell.

In order to mediate its toxic activity, CT binds with excessive affinity to the GM1 ganglioside in lipid rafts on the epidermal cell surface of the lumen of the small intestine. The excessive binding affinity of CTB to the ganglioside GM1 is as a result of contribution of a single amino acid on the neighboring CTB monomer to the GM1 binding website on an adjoining CTB monomer . Subsequently, the crystal structure of CT revealed that Tyr12 on the CTB monomer, along with Gly33 and Trp88 on the adjacent monomer, are important for CT-GM1 interplay . Historically, AB subunit toxins synthesized by a wide range of bacterial pathogens and plants have occupied a loathsome place in man’s lexicon. More recently nevertheless, there has emerged a extra optimistic and inspiring story suggesting that AB toxins could quickly become considered one of man’s finest allies within the battle towards infection and autoimmunity. During the previous two decades, AB toxins have shown growing promise as efficient, safe, and sturdy adjuvants for the stimulation of immunity or alternatively, the suppression of autoimmunity. In this evaluate, we examine the similarities and variations within the structure and function of bacterial and plant AB toxins in anticipation of the scientific challenges and strategic priorities required for modern vaccine growth .
